Patients allowed to weight-bear as tolerated immediately after meniscus repair did not have higher failure rates than patients who had a traditional non-weight-bearing protocol, according to results presented here. Tompkins and colleagues categorized 295 patients who underwent meniscus repair between 2006 and 2009 into the following two groups: non-weight-bearing; or weight-bearing as tolerated immediately following surgery. In isolated meniscal repair patients (n = 62), there was no difference between weight-bearing groups for rate of re-operation (n.s.).
